Death Note
Light finds a death note on the ground. He finds out that whoever writes in it dies. He then chooses to rid the world of evil. He spends lots of time killing people who have done wrong! Meanwhile, there is a guy tracking him down to catch him and stop him for killing. This book is full of twists and turns. It’s a great cat and mouse chase. --Reviewed by Destiny Brown
Godchild
This is a very good book if you like investigations and murders. It’s about a guy named Cain who is investigating murders and who did it. He has a stepsister who is 7 – they get into all these different things. Everyone is out to kill Lord Cain, but he always manages to survive with the help of his butler. --Reviewed by Koda Brown
